The Machine Learning Contest: An New Period of Digital Dominance

The escalating dynamic between the United States and China is reshaping the global landscape, and at its center lies the fierce pursuit of AI leadership. Washington and Beijing nations are substantially investing in innovation, personnel, and computing power to establish a strategic advantage. This isn’t merely about creating smarter algorithms; it's about defining the future of markets, from medicine to national security and beyond, potentially redefining the geopolitical balance. The quest is characterized by distinct approaches—the US emphasizing a more open innovation model while China inclines a centralized strategy—and carries profound implications for international stability.

Shaping the Synthetic Intelligence Transformation: Policy Challenges in a Intensely Competitive World

The rapid proliferation of artificial intelligence presents a novel set of governance dilemmas, particularly within a global landscape characterized by heightened competition. Nations are vying for advantage in AI development and deployment, leading to a fragmented approach to standards. This scenario necessitates careful consideration of how to foster innovation while mitigating foreseeable risks, such as algorithmic bias, job loss, and the moral implications of increasingly independent systems. A unified international framework is desperately needed, but achieving consensus amongst rival interests and conflicting national priorities remains a substantial hurdle, potentially exacerbating inequalities and fueling a dangerous innovation race.

This Superintelligent Transition: Implications for Global Power and Administration

The potential emergence of a superintelligent machine intelligence – often linked to the concept of the technological breakthrough – presents profound challenges for the established order of global power and governance. Existing geopolitical balances are predicated on the relative power of nation-states, but a superintelligence could rapidly alter this landscape, potentially creating a power dynamic far beyond the comprehension or reach of any single state or coalition. Questions arise regarding who would direct such an intelligence; would it be centralized under a single power, leading to unprecedented global hegemony, or would its influence be diffused across multiple factions? The lack of sufficient frameworks for addressing this emerging scenario necessitates urgent consideration and the exploration of novel forms of universal cooperation to navigate what could be the most significant revolution in human history. Ultimately, ensuring a beneficial consequence requires proactively designing governance processes capable of aligning a superintelligence's goals with mankind's values.
